No, I think this fits here, this is consumer stuff. First you need to decide what your needs are - are you going to be travelling to different countries? If so, GSM is for you. Why? Because the SIM card can be removed and information is not hard-wired to the phone as is the case, I believe, with CDMA.

You can simply remove the SIM card and have a phone that will be able to do nothing. The advantage here is if you go to Europe and get a SIM card there, all your calls are local.

What do you mean by asking if there is a process in doing so? Nokia started selling unlocked phones from their site.

Yeah that's the idea with GSM phones. Once you get the right phone (operating on all bands) then yeah, any SIM will work, that's the beauty of it. Once you store your contacts on the SIM, your contacts move with you. If you store them on the phone, contacts will be there regardless of the SIM and you can easily transfer contacts from phone to card.
